The National Federation of the Blind (NFB) is an organization of blind people in the
U.S. It is the oldest and largest organization led by blind people in the United States.
The National Federation of the Blind offers many programs, services, and resources
for blind and low-vision people in the United States.
Free White Cane Program:
The National Federation of the Blind has distributed more than 64,000 free white canes since 2008. The white cane gives blind people the ability to achieve a full & independent life, allowing us to travel freely and safely. We started our free white cane program because we believe that no blind person should be without a white cane, regardless of his or her ability to pay for it. Free Slate and Stylus Program:
The National Federation of the Blind will distribute a plastic, four-line, twenty-eight cell slate along with a saddle stylus to those that need them. That includes those that are blind and low vision who know Braille or want to learn Braille. The slate and stylus have long been and continue to be valuable tools for writing Braille, which is vital to literacy for the blind. It is the only Braille-writing device that has the same portability, flexibility, and affordability as a pen and pencil. From labeling your canned goods to jotting down a phone number, the uses and advantages of the slate and stylus for the blind are as varied as those of a pen and pencil for the sighted.
